Within the XRPL (XRP Ledger) community, a heated debate ensues among developers regarding the potential prioritization of transactions based on higher fees. đŒđ
đ€ The Fee Priority Conundrum đđ
The core of the debate revolves around the proposal to prioritize transactions with higher fees, sparking discussions on fairness, network efficiency, and the potential implications for users and network dynamics.
đĄ Optimizing Network Performance âïžđ
Advocates of this approach argue that prioritizing transactions with higher fees could streamline network operations, enhancing efficiency during times of congestion and possibly incentivizing users to offer higher fees for faster processing.
đ Balancing Fairness and Functionality âïžđ
However, opponents express concerns regarding the equitable nature of such prioritization. They emphasize the importance of maintaining an inclusive and fair transaction environment for all users, regardless of fee amounts.
đ Impact on User Experience đŒđ
The potential adoption of this proposal could significantly affect users' transaction experiences within the XRPL ecosystem. Understanding the balance between network optimization and user satisfaction becomes a pivotal aspect of the ongoing discussions.
